Output 200076704aec87499ac78f2481d9c3f1c666b0c0daaa01ea18fca6a0afc2cdc5:1

value
26574110
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a7b144c291dead9fc1af897d554775f718fc8997 OP_EQUAL
address
MPBqSJZuMCsKepZR1TX156Qu3ZB1yrNhUQ
transaction
200076704aec87499ac78f2481d9c3f1c666b0c0daaa01ea18fca6a0afc2cdc5
spent
true